摘要:
Alzheimer's disease (AD) is a serious, common, global disease, yet its etiology and pathogenesis are incompletely understood. Air pollution is a multi-pollutants coexposure system, which may affect brain. The indoor environment is where exposure to both air particulate matter (< 2.5 μm in diameter) (PM2.5) and formaldehyde (FA) can occur simultaneously.
